The key to beating cancer is to catch it early. Always keep a regular schedule of tests and screenings so you can catch any existence of cancer cells at an early stage before it becomes worse. For cancers such as those of the breast and testes, make sure that you do monthly self-exams so that you can notice anything out of the ordinary.

Alcohol consumption has no safe amount when it concerns the risk of cancer. If you are prone to drinking excessive amounts of alcohol, you put yourself in danger of having a higher likelihood of certain forms of cancer. Cancers of the mouth, throat, and esophagus are especially threats if you consume too much alcohol. If you don’t want to eliminate alcohol altogether, at least limit your drinking and keep tabs on yourself to ensure you don’t overindulge.

If diarrhea is one of the side effects of your cancer treatments, then you should consider cutting back on other irritants like coffee. While coffee provides that boost to help keep you going, it only increases your chances of having diarrhea. Try to avoid any beverages that contain caffeine in order to reduce the severity of your diarrhea.
